Post by 3rob3 » Mon Mar 28, 2016 1:11 pm

Crash2009 wrote:Step 0 I got an error with rd c:\programdata\microsoft\ehome /s /q The error was the files were in use by another process. I ignored the error and continued anyway.
I ran into this too. The culprit, for me, was Ceton My Media Center. You need to stop the CDataSvc before deleting the eHome directory, use this command in an elevated command prompt:
sc stop "CDataSvc"

It will start itself normally after a reboot. This should probably be added to the FAQ.

Post by Crash2009 » Mon Mar 28, 2016 2:10 pm

Crash2009 wrote:Step 0 I got an error with rd c:\programdata\microsoft\ehome /s /q The error was the files were in use by another process. I ignored the error and continued anyway.
3rob3 wrote:I ran into this too. The culprit, for me, was Ceton My Media Center. You need to stop the CDataSvc before deleting the eHome directory, use this command in an elevated command prompt:
sc stop "CDataSvc"

It will start itself normally after a reboot. This should probably be added to the FAQ.
STC wrote:Going in under safe mode is also a sure fire way of performing the task cleanly.
Its has to be MMC/CData. I was drawing a blank as to what else (other than GuideTool or MCL) could possibly be hanging on to C:\ProgramData\Microsoft\ehome\mcepg3-5. I did delete the folders and files from Safe Mode. The strange thing to me, is/was mcepgX-X was re-generated upon booting into normal.

Maybe we should add a line or two to Step 0 or Readme.txt?

sc stop "CDataSvc"


net stop ehrecvr
net stop ehsched
rd c:\programdata\microsoft\ehome /s /q
net start ehrecvr

Do GuideTool and MCL have a service that might need to be stopped as well? I just remembered something, I had/have YAMM running also.

It wouldn't be any big deal to uninstall all 4, if it would eliminate problems.

Post by glorp » Mon Mar 28, 2016 2:54 pm

3rob3 wrote:
Crash2009 wrote:Step 0 I got an error with rd c:\programdata\microsoft\ehome /s /q The error was the files were in use by another process. I ignored the error and continued anyway.
I ran into this too. The culprit, for me, was Ceton My Media Center. You need to stop the CDataSvc before deleting the eHome directory, use this command in an elevated command prompt:
sc stop "CDataSvc"

It will start itself normally after a reboot. This should probably be added to the FAQ.
Ceton InfiniTVSvc as well locks files. I had forgotten to mention that before. Anyone with a Ceton tuner will have this service running and it may need to be stopped.
